Gas heating repair services involve diagnosing and fixing issues with residential or commercial gas-powered heating systems. These services are essential for ensuring that gas furnaces, boilers, and space heaters operate safely and efficiently during colder months. Skilled service providers inspect the system components, identify faults such as faulty burners, broken thermostats, or damaged heat exchangers, and perform necessary repairs to restore proper function. Regular maintenance and prompt repairs can help prevent unexpected breakdowns and extend the lifespan of the heating equipment.

Common problems addressed by gas heating repair include inconsistent heating, unusual noises, pilot light or ignition failures, and increased energy bills. These issues often stem from worn-out parts, gas leaks, or electrical problems within the system. Service providers can also assist with more complex issues like carbon monoxide leaks or system failures that pose safety concerns. Timely repairs not only improve comfort but also reduce the risk of dangerous situations related to gas system malfunctions, making professional intervention a critical step when problems arise.

The overview below groups typical Gas Heating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Most routine gas heating repairs, such as fixing pilot lights or thermostats, typically cost between $150 and $400. Many local contractors handle these common issues within this range, making them accessible for standard service needs.

Medium Repairs - More involved repairs, like replacing burners or fixing gas valves, usually fall between $400 and $1,200. These projects are common and often represent the middle of the typical cost spectrum for gas heating services.

Full System Replacement - Replacing an entire gas furnace or heater can range from $2,500 to $5,000 or more, depending on the unit and installation complexity. Larger, more comprehensive projects tend to reach into this higher cost bracket.

Complex or Unusual Projects - Rare, extensive repairs or upgrades, such as system conversions or extensive ductwork, can exceed $5,000. These higher-tier projects are less common but are handled by local service providers for specialized needs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s that a gas heating system needs repair? Indicators include inconsistent heating, unusual noises, or a pilot light that keeps going out. If these signs occur, it’s advisable to have a professional inspection to determine necessary repairs.

How do local contractors typically diagnose gas heating issues? They perform a thorough inspection of the system, checking components such as the pilot light, thermocouple, and gas supply lines to identify the source of the problem.

Can a gas heating system be repaired instead of replaced? Many issues can be addressed through repairs, especially if the system is relatively new and well-maintained. A qualified service provider can assess whether repair is a practical option.

What safety precautions do service providers take during gas heating repairs? Technicians follow standard safety procedures, including turning off the gas supply and inspecting for leaks, to ensure safe and effective repairs.
